Ecm Titanium Smartkey.dll Error Fix ((top))
Do not update your operating system without backing up your working tuning folders.
Look for recent blocks related to SmartKey.dll or your ECM Titanium installation folder. Select the file and click or Allow on device .
The smartkey.dll error is rarely a sign of broken hardware; it is almost always a software communication breakdown. By restoring the file from quarantine, white-listing the directory, and ensuring the Keylok/Smartkey drivers are freshly installed, you can get your tuning software back up and running smoothly. To help narrow down the issue further, please share:
Add the entire ECM Titanium installation folder (usually located in C:\Program Files (x86)\ or directly on your C:\ drive) to your antivirus to prevent it from happening again. 2. Reinstall the Smartkey USB Drivers
This is the leading cause of failure on modern PCs. ecm titanium smartkey.dll error fix
The smartkey.dll file is a dynamic link library. It handles security and hardware key licensing for ECM Titanium. Common reasons for this error: Antivirus software quarantined the file. Windows Defender deleted the file during installation. The file is corrupted. The software installation directory is incorrect. Direct Fixes for smartkey.dll Errors 1. Restore the File from Antivirus Quarantine
: Some versions include an alternate setup file in the directory, such as ECM4freesetup32.exe , which may bypass certain DLL checks. Install System Dependencies
Because this software was originally designed for older Windows environments, many professionals use a VirtualBox or VMware instance running Windows XP or Windows 7 (x86) to avoid DLL conflicts entirely. Common Causes of the Error
Fresh installation ensures no corrupted files remain from a failed setup. Do not update your operating system without backing
If you are using a cracked version and smartkey.dll is missing, you likely need a known working version of this file, often shared in forums r/ECU_Tuning - Reddit .
In the world of automotive ECU tuning, ECM Titanium stands as a powerful tool for modifying engine map files. However, its sophisticated security measures—specifically the use of a hardware-based security dongle—can often lead to the "smartkey.dll not found" or "module could not be found" error. This specific DLL (Dynamic Link Library) serves as the bridge between the software and the hardware key; without it, the application fails to initialize as a protection against unauthorized use.
If none of the above steps work, your installation files or registry entries may be too corrupted to salvage. A clean reinstallation will rebuild the software environment. Disconnect your USB smartkey.
Copy and paste it directly into the root folder where ECM_Titanium.exe is located. Method B: Reinstall the Software The smartkey
Do not attempt to download smartkey.dll from random "DLL Download" websites. These files are often specific to
A: Try a Windows System Restore to a date before the error started. If that fails, consider reinstalling Windows (keep a separate partition for automotive tools).
How to Fix the ECM Titanium smartkey.dll Error: A Complete Guide